Evaluate and compare the driving behaviour of people.
SummaryContentThe driver behaviour / driving analysis allows an evaluation of the driving behaviour of people. The reportcenter calculate from each journey in compliance with a variety of evaluation criteria a score from 1 to 10(1=poor, 10=excellent). The report note the trip difficulty. This allows a comparison of drivers with different vehicle types and use cases. The driver behaviour / driving analysis allows a detailed view on the events that have occured and external influences. It contains informations, that analyze the whole period, but also detailed view that explain every single ride. Configuration / PreferencesThe following configurations can be made only for vehicles(detection devices) that have booked the corresponding option. Configure limits for vehicleTo perform a driver behaviour / driving analysis, you have to define once at the beginning some limits for the involved vehicles. Configure the follwing limits for a vehicle in the object settings under the rubric driverbehaviour:
YellowFox offer a default configuration for cars and trucks. These can be loaded in the upper part of the configuration dialog. By saving it, the configuration is sent to the vehicle(detection device). Evaluation profilesIt's possible to set a evaluation profile for each vehicle(detection device) on the use case. This describe the weight between the different evaluation criteria. YellowFox offers you a pre-selection of profiles for the vehicle types truck, car, van, bus,... .
